Temperature-dependent optical constants of monolayer MoS2, MoSe2, WS2, and WSe2: spectroscopic ellipsometry and first-principles calculations

AbstractThe temperature-dependent ( T = 4.5 - 500 K) optical constants of monolayer MoS2, MoSe2, WS2, and WSe 2 were investigated through spectroscopic ellipsometry over the spectral range of 0.73-6.42 eV. At room temperature, the spectra of refractive index exhibited several anomalous dispersion features below 800 nm and approached a constant value of 3.5-4.0 in the near-infrared frequency range. With a decrease in temperature, the refractive indices decreased monotonically in the nearinfrared region due to the temperature-dependent optical band gap. The thermo-optic coefficients at room temperature had values from 6.1 x 10(-5) to 2.6 x 10(-4) K-1 for monolayer transition metal dichalcogenides at a wavelength of 1200 nm below the optical band gap. The optical band gap increased with a decrease in temperature due to the suppression of electron- phonon interactions. On the basis of first-principles calculations, the observed optical excitations at 4.5 K were appropriately assigned. These results provide basic information for the technological development of monolayer transition metal dichalcogenides-based photonic devices at various temperatures.
